Screenless thought catcher captures inspiration using raspberry pi and notion

A new screenless device called the Thought Catcher uses a Raspberry Pi and Notion to record flashes of inspiration without distractions. Designed to minimize interruptions during sleep, this AI gadget has caught the attention of tech enthusiasts. It offers a simple way to note ideas on the go.

The Thought Catcher is a innovative, screenless gadget that leverages a Raspberry Pi microcontroller and the Notion productivity app to capture spontaneous ideas. By eliminating visual displays, it aims to reduce distractions, particularly when users are trying to sleep or focus on other tasks.

According to a TechRadar review, this device stands out among AI gadgets for its practical appeal. The author expresses genuine interest in owning one, highlighting its potential to preserve creative sparks without the pull of smartphone notifications.

Built for minimalism, the Thought Catcher integrates seamlessly with Notion's database features, allowing users to log thoughts via voice or simple inputs. This setup ensures ideas are stored efficiently for later review, promoting better rest and productivity.

While details on availability and pricing remain undisclosed in the initial coverage, the gadget's emphasis on distraction-free functionality addresses a common modern challenge. Its reliance on open-source hardware like Raspberry Pi makes it accessible for tinkerers and developers.

Pebble announces Index 01 ring for voice notes

由 AI 报道 AI 生成的图像

Nearly a decade after its original smartwatch venture ended, Pebble has returned with the Index 01, a simple ring designed solely for capturing voice notes. Priced at $75 during preorder, the device uses local AI on your phone to process recordings into actions like setting reminders or creating notes, without any cloud involvement or charging requirements. Shipping begins in March 2026.

Plaud has introduced the NotePin S, an updated AI wearable designed for recording and summarizing conversations, just in time for CES 2026. The device features a new button to flag key moments and is available now for $179. It aims to assist users in busy environments like conferences by capturing audio and generating transcriptions via a companion app.

A new wearable device from MIT's AlterEgo company uses technology to interpret subtle neuromuscular signals for silent communication. The device, worn on the ears, enables tasks like conversation and device control without vocalizing words. While it offers privacy benefits, it also raises concerns about data handling in interactions.

At CES 2026, Luna unveiled the Luna Band, a screenless wristband that logs health data through voice commands, eliminating the need for apps or annual subscriptions. Unlike competitors such as the Whoop 5.0, this device offers a subscription-free alternative for monitoring fitness and wellness. It integrates AI to provide contextual insights into users' health routines.

At Mobile World Congress 2026 in Barcelona, Lenovo unveiled the ThinkBook Modular AI PC Concept, a 14-inch dual-screen laptop with detachable displays, swappable keyboards, and hot-swappable ports for versatile productivity. While not headed to retail, it previews modular features alongside new ThinkPad models emphasizing repairability, including the T14 Gen 7 and rugged X11 tablet.

As CES 2026 approaches, experts anticipate significant advancements in smart home technology driven by artificial intelligence. Predictions highlight more conversational voice assistants, noninvasive presence sensing, and automated routines that reduce human input. These developments aim to address longstanding issues like compatibility and privacy in connected homes.
